Key Insights
The Variable Valve Timing (VVT) and Start-Stop System market is experiencing robust growth, driven by stringent emission regulations globally and the increasing demand for fuel-efficient vehicles. The market, valued at approximately $15 billion in 2025, is projected to exhibit a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 7% from 2025 to 2033, reaching an estimated market value of $28 billion by 2033. This growth is fueled by several key factors. Firstly, advancements in VVT technology are leading to improved engine performance and fuel economy, making it a crucial component in modern vehicles. Secondly, the widespread adoption of start-stop systems is contributing significantly to reduced fuel consumption and emissions, particularly in urban driving conditions. Key players like Valeo, Hitachi, and Schaeffler are at the forefront of innovation, constantly developing advanced systems and expanding their market presence through strategic partnerships and acquisitions. The market is segmented by vehicle type (passenger cars, commercial vehicles), technology type (hydraulic, electric, electro-hydraulic), and geographic region. While the growth is significant, challenges remain. The high initial cost of implementing these technologies can be a barrier for entry, especially in developing markets. Furthermore, the reliability and durability of these systems need continuous improvement to maintain consumer trust and widespread adoption.

The competitive landscape is highly fragmented, with both established automotive suppliers and original equipment manufacturers (OEMs) vying for market share. Technological advancements, such as the integration of AI and machine learning for optimized engine control, are reshaping the market dynamics. The increasing adoption of hybrid and electric vehicles is also influencing the VVT and start-stop systems market, with manufacturers adapting their technologies to meet the specific requirements of these powertrains. Regional variations in emission standards and fuel prices impact the market growth differently, with North America and Europe currently leading the adoption, followed by Asia-Pacific experiencing rapid growth. Continuous research and development focused on improving system efficiency, reducing cost, and enhancing reliability will be vital for sustained market expansion in the coming years.
